ozan
|
e96c7c5bf1
|
feat: CI orchestrator — Lambda dispatch + Fargate routing + cancel
dispatch: receives Gitea webhook, routes by runs-on label to Fargate
tasks (go/node/docker/godot) or Lambda executor (deploy).
Path filter evaluation, DynamoDB run tracking, cancel via StopTask.
exec: lightweight Lambda for deploy-only jobs (S3 sync, ECS update).
SAM template: API Gateway + 2 Lambdas + DynamoDB + cleanup cron.
|
2026-05-22 18:47:47 +01:00 |
|